FTIR Exhaust Gas Analyzer - Direct Measurement Type

The FTX-ONE CS/RS is a compact, fast-response FTIR analyzer designed for direct measurement of engine exhaust gas. Equipped with a high-performance optical cell and multivariate analysis, it measures up to 28 exhaust gas components—such as NH₃, CO₂, and CH₄—at 5 Hz sampling rate using Fourier Transform Infrared technology.

Why Choose FTX-ONE-CS/RS

  • Ultra-Fast Detection – Achieves approximately 1.5-second response for difficult-to-measure gases like ammonia.

  • Low Sampling Flow – Uses minimal exhaust draw to avoid impact on engine combustion or catalyst behavior.

  • Highly Compact Design – Occupies about half the space and weight of conventional FTIR systems, offering greater lab flexibility.

  • Versatile Dual Model – The RS variant adds THC and O₂ detection, enabling rich insights like AFR and fuel consumption from one unit.
